Swiss Post - Logotype

Swiss Post

Swiss Post is the postal service of Switzerland. A public company owned by the Swiss Confederation. The group is based in Bern.

  • Size: Large
  • Type: State-owned company
  • Listed: Non-listed
  • Sector: Logistics
  • Country: Switzerland
  • Country Status: OECD
  • Employees: 50,000 - 100,000
  • Revenue: 8800000000 USD
  • GRI Community: Not provided
  • Stock listing code: Not provided


www: visit
HQ Address: Wankdorfallee 4
HQ City: 3030 Berne
Contact person: Not provided
Email: send email




As the largest logistics company in Switzerland, Swiss Post operates an energy-intensive business.


Swiss Post is renewing its vehicle fleet and building stock, is using more alternative drive systems and optimizing delivery rounds. These measures not only reduce the risks of operating an energy-intesive business but also generate competitive advantages.